Apple releases new macOS 11.0.1 Big Sur update

Big Sur macOS

New version available of macOS 11.0.1 Big Sur arrives for some users. This is not a general update for all users and it is not a new version exclusively for developers, this is a system update for some users affected by some type of failure.

As happened a day ago with the arrival of a new version of iOS (which in that case it was for all iPhone 12 users) some of the Mac users who have the latest version installed on their computer have received a notification with the new version available.

Apple has updated version 11.0.1 to build 20B50 with 20B29 being the first version. So everyone who skips this new version can now install it to solve possible problems or it is even possible that this new version only appears to users who have not yet installed the first version released by Apple. By this we mean that it is possible that it is a version that corrects some problem in the installation as happened with the iOS one.

For now, the Cupertino company does not usually launch so many versions of its operating systems in a row but right now it is fine-tuning both and it may be that in this case it is some code for the installation, little more. In short, we can already confirm that it is not a version that adds new features in its operation beyond solve a problem detected for some specific computers. Did the new version jump to you?
